KNCI's Mailey Retires
KNCI's Mailey Retires: Bonneville KNCI/Sacramento morning co-host and Country Radio Hall of Famer Tom Mailey has retired. Co-hosts Pat Still and Cody Robinson will continue as a two-person show starting May 19. Mailey's radio career goes back 42 years, the last 32 of which have been at KNCI and its predecessor KRAK. He and Still were inducted into the Country Radio Hall of Fame last year; see their profile here. "Fishing's always been a passion," Mailey shared on social media.
